<Balance> is a friends and family gaming community focused on progressing together while maintaining an adult environment and "balancing" real life with this game. That being said, we're NOT a "casual" raiding guild. If you feel some people take raiding "too serious" then this is not the guild for you.
We are a guild that strives to clear progression content ("hardcore" to some) yet enjoy the company of the guild on off nights by playing alts, goofing around, or spending time with our families. We believe that it is possible to experience ALL major endgame raid content without spending a majority of our week doing so. However, that means our raids MUST be focused and get the job done in the time we allot per week; it's a constant battle for us to raid hard yet not turn into assholes.
So what makes <Balance> different from all the other "casual hard-core raiding guilds" out there that have popped up since Wrath of the Lich King?
1. We were formed in Feb 2007, and we have been successful raiding 9 hours a week since then from Karazhan to Trial of the Crusader.
- What this means to you is we're not a new guild. We are the original guild on Bronzebeard who pioneered the notion beginning in TBC that it WAS possible to spend less time raiding but achieve the same results. As you can see, other similar guilds have mirrored their raid/guild approaches to the model we've created through trial and error over the past 2.5+ years.
2. We have defeated all 25pp encounters (with the exception of Algalon) up to Putricide. - What this means to you is we get things done. Initially the new released Xpac content was super easy and there were so many new guilds popping up which made recruitment very difficult. We managed to clear 3D, Yogg, and up to HTwins in ToTGC. With our nine hour weekly raid schedule it's been a challenge to find sufficient learning time for hard modes and unlocking Algalon, but Arthas is our ultimate goal.
3. 3.3's goal will be to start ICC immediately to continue content pace so we are prepared to kill Arthas when he is released. - What this means to you is we're going to kill Arthas. We don't want to fall behind content pace and not have a realistic shot at Arthas before Cataclysm. As you know, once that happens raid motivation takes a big hit, which is what happened to some of our key raiders in our guild during Illidan in September 2008.
4. Our median age for this guild is from 25 - 35. - What this means to you is that there are adults leading and playing in this guild and we place a HIGH emphasis on accountability and communication. You are treated with respect, and likewise we expect our responsible members to not act the fool in public and to communicate weekly. Any displays/proof of douchebaggery will be handled appropriately despite "skill". 25pp guild sponsored raid progression - Prince Council cleared 1/24 - Festergut & Rotface cleared 1/7 & 1/10 - Heroic Faction Champs cleared 11/5/09 - Ulduar: Yogg cleared 8/9/09 - Sartharian 3D cleared - Malygos cleared - Naxx cleared
Just as we did in TBC, our three raid days are Wednesdays/Thursdays 6pm-9pm and Sundays 430pm-730pm. Invites are 30 minutes prior and all times are PST.
